TECHNIQUES FOR SPAWNING ENTITIES IN A VIRTUAL ENVIRONMENT

      
Application Number 18076356
Status Pending
Filing Date 2022-12-06
First Publication Date 2023-06-08
Owner Blizzard Entertainment, Inc. (USA)
Inventor
  • Stockton, Iii, Cory
  • Story, Dan
  • Chapman, Joshua
  • Zondler, Jared

Abstract

A system is described for weighting and evaluating potential spawn locations by sampling player position to determine a general direction and velocity of travel, thereby allowing the game to favor placing spawns along the player's projected path. In addition, techniques are provided where a game server provides a client a signature value to seed a deterministic pseudorandom number generator to spawn an object at the client. When the client wishes to communicate a player interaction to the server, it transmits the operation the player wants to perform and the identifying information it was originally given. The server uses this data and re-compute the signature using a secret key. If the signature values match, then the server knows the spawn ID and the signature value are legitimate.

TECHNIQUES FOR COMBINING GEO-DEPENDENT AND GEO-INDEPENDENT EXPERIENCES IN A VIRTUAL ENVIRONMENT

      
Application Number 17974175
Status Pending
Filing Date 2022-10-26
First Publication Date 2023-04-27
Owner Blizzard Entertainment, Inc. (USA)
Inventor
  • Stockton, Cory
  • Mccabe, Chris
  • White, Charlie
  • Bernau, Russell
  • Beissinger, Peter

Abstract

Techniques for combining geo-dependent and geo-independent experiences in a virtual environment are provided. In one technique, a first geographic location of a first user is received from a first user's device. A second geographic location of a second user is received from a second user's device. Group data that (1) identifies both users as members of a group and (2) identifies an objective to complete in a virtual environment is stored. Completion of the objective requires performance of multiple tasks. Action data that indicates an action, performed while at the first geographic location, that is related to performance of one of the tasks, is received from the first user's device. Similar action data (except with respect to the second geographic and another task) is received from the second user's device. Based on both action data, the group data is updated to indicate that the group completed the objective.

MACHINE LEARNING-BASED 2D STRUCTURED IMAGE GENERATION

      
Application Number 18087809
Status Pending
Filing Date 2022-12-23
First Publication Date 2023-04-27
Owner Blizzard Entertainment, Inc. (USA)
Inventor
  • Chen, Shuo
  • Rogic, Denis

Abstract

Techniques are described for a multiple-phase process that uses machine learning (ML) models to produce a texturized version of an input image. During a first phase, using a pix2pix-based ML model, an automatically-generated image that depicts structured texture is generated based on an input image that visually identifies a plurality of image areas for the structured texture. During a second phase, a neural style transfer-based ML model is used to apply the style of a style image (e.g., a target image from the training dataset of the pix2pix-based ML model) to the texture image generated at the first phase (the content image) to produce a modified texture image. According to an embodiment, during a third phase, the generated texture image produced at the first phase and the modified texture image produced at the second phase are combined to produce a structured texture image with a moderated amount of detail.

Techniques for user rankings within gaming systems

      
Application Number 17338536
Grant Number 11612821
Status In Force
Filing Date 2021-06-03
First Publication Date 2022-12-08
Grant Date 2023-03-28
Owner Blizzard Entertainment, Inc. (USA)
Inventor Ding, Tian

Abstract

Techniques are described herein for a gaming system that maintains an internal score and an external score for each user. The system maintains the internal scores to reflect demonstrated user skill. The system uses the accurate internal scores to facilitate communication between client computing devices associated with users that have been selected to participate in gameplay instances based on the internal scores. The external scores maintained by the system displayed to the users. Because the external scores are not used for matchmaking, the external scores may be adjusted in any way without requiring internal consistency. For example, to combat gameplay stagnation, the gameplay system periodically resets maintained external scores. For a time, comparisons between the reset external scores do not accurately reflect the users' rankings within the game. However, as the users participate in gameplay, the external scores return to levels that are similar to the users' internal scores.

TECHNIQUES FOR OFFERING SYNERGISTIC BUNDLES IN GAMES INVOLVING GAME-SETS OF PLAY-ITEMS

      
Application Number 17333494
Status Pending
Filing Date 2021-05-28
First Publication Date 2022-12-01
Owner Blizzard Entertainment, Inc. (USA)
Inventor Ding, Tian

Abstract

Techniques are described herein for automatically pre-constructing bundles of play-items based on the degree of synergy between the play-items. The degree of synergy between play-items is determined empirically, based on contents of player-constructed game-sets and outcomes of actual games using those game-sets. Automatically pre-constructing bundles involves generating pairwise synergy scores between every possible pair of play-items, and then (for bundles containing more than two items) using those pairwise synergy scores to determine bundle-wise synergy scores. Techniques are provided for identifying candidate bundle(s) of play-items to offer or award to a player. The candidate bundles are determined based on synergies between the play-items in each of the pre-constructed bundles and the play-items in the player's specific game-set.

Prop placement with machine learning

      
Application Number 17327187
Grant Number 11890544
Status In Force
Filing Date 2021-05-21
First Publication Date 2022-06-30
Grant Date 2024-02-06
Owner BLIZZARD ENTERTAINMENT, INC. (USA)
Inventor
  • Zhai, Zhen
  • Supancic, Iii, James Steven

Abstract

Techniques are described herein for facilitating the placement of props on maps by an automated prop placement tool that makes use of a trained machine learning mechanism. The machine learning mechanism is trained based on one or more training maps upon which props have been placed. The machine learning mechanism may be trained to suggest placement based on (a) spatial rules relating, (b) prop-specific rules, (c) prop-to-fixed-object distances between props and map structures, and (d) distances between props. Once the machine learning mechanism is trained, the prop placement tool may be provided as input (a) map data that defines a target map and (b) prop data that specifies the set of target props to be placed on the target map. Based on this input and the machine learning mechanism's trained model, the prop placement tool outputs a suggested placement, for each of the target props, on the target map.

Determining play of the game based on gameplay events

      
Application Number 15374523
Grant Number 10456680
Status In Force
Filing Date 2016-12-09
First Publication Date 2018-06-14
Grant Date 2019-10-29
Owner Blizzard Entertainment, Inc. (USA)
Inventor
  • Miron, Keith
  • Goodman, Geoff

Abstract

In an approach, a game server records events that occur within a match of a video game played using a plurality of game clients. After the match has concluded, the game server scores the events according to a plurality of criteria corresponding a plurality of play of the game categories. A sliding window is passed over the events in a number of increments. During each increment, the score for each event that falls within the sliding window is aggregated for each of the categories. The game server then selects a play of the game category and determines the top aggregated score for that category. Once determined, the game server sends one or more instructions to the game clients which causes the game clients to display a replay of the events that occurred during the time window increment corresponding to the top aggregated score for the selected category.

Cross-realm zones for interactive gameplay

      
Application Number 14977992
Grant Number 10086279
Status In Force
Filing Date 2015-12-22
First Publication Date 2016-05-05
Grant Date 2018-10-02
Owner Blizzard Entertainment, Inc. (USA)
Inventor
  • Dun, Alec
  • Mccathern, Kurtis
  • Elliott, Michael
  • Brack, J. Allen
  • Chilton, Tom

Abstract

Methods, computer-readable media, and specially configured machines are described for hosting an instance of a cross-realm zone that manages interaction among characters from different instances of a virtual world in a massively multiplayer online game. Different zones of the virtual world may support different numbers of realms or different combinations of realms, and some zones of the virtual world may remain as single-realm zones. When a character enters a zone, the character may be added to an instance of a cross-realm zone based on the virtual world for which the character is a member. A single cross-realm zone may handle all characters that enter the zone from a subset of realms, but not characters that enter the zone from other realms that are not in the subset of realms. Characters in a cross-realm zone might not have any affiliation or prior social connection or interaction with each other.

Encouraging player socialization using a nemesis and avenger system

      
Application Number 14792423
Grant Number 09539518
Status In Force
Filing Date 2015-07-06
First Publication Date 2016-01-14
Grant Date 2017-01-10
Owner Blizzard Entertainment, Inc. (USA)
Inventor
  • Berger, Matthew
  • Greenstone, Evan

Abstract

In an approach, one or more player characters controllable by a first player account perform an action in an instance of a game world. In the event that the action meets one or more conditions for creating a nemesis, a computer system controlling the game instance selects a second player account to be invaded by a nemesis. When the second player account plays the game in the same or a different game instance, the computer system determines whether second one or more characters of the selected account meet one or more invasion conditions. If the invasion conditions are met, the computer system generates computer-controlled enemy NPCs for second one or more characters of the second player account to defeat. If the second account defeats the nemesis invasion, rewards are generated for the first and second player accounts. Otherwise, the computer system chooses a third player account for nemesis invasion.
